ICH5 w/ Debian Sarge
I have four hard drives in my machine. Two are IDE, which work fine and hold the Debian install. My two other drives are SATA. When I install the system, the two SATA drives are fine and I format them. But when I boot into my system, I get a mount error on the two SATA drives saying /dev/sda1 is not there.
I tell it to continue anyway (with CTRL-D) and it finishes booting up, both the SATA drives not mounted. I can run mount -a one the machine has started up and the two SATA drives are both mounted fine.
How is it that the two drives cannot be mounted on boot, but can once the machine is fully started. Is there a module that is loaded between? Is the ICH5 Intel controller supported? Any help would be great. Thanks!
